Episode 9’s most innovative thematic contribution is its depiction of the harem as a rather than a purely romantic gathering. The bedroom is an extension of the labyrinth.

During a routine skirmish, a monster successfully inflicts a sleep status ailment on Michio. Left completely defenseless, his beastkin slave and combat partner, Roxanne, is forced to defend him single-handedly, sustaining notable injuries in the process. Much of the episode centers on Michio and Roxanne giving Sherry her first bath. Michio introduces the use of soap, which is a rare and expensive luxury in this world.

Michio and Roxanne spend time shopping for their new house, purchasing bathroom supplies, gardening tools, and preparing garden beds. They also settle into their new rural home on the outskirts of Quratar, which features a flushing toilet and a neglected garden. The Labyrinth & Tactical Change:

The episode shifts between lighthearted domestic life and the harsh reality of dungeon crawling. While Michio and Roxanne enjoy their "Simple Life" by improving their home, a near-fatal encounter in the labyrinth forces Michio to reconsider his party's structure. Isekai Meikyuu De Harem Wo (often translated as Harem in the Labyrinth of Another World ) distinguishes itself within the isekai genre through its methodical, game-mechanic-driven approach to survival and its explicit, transactional depiction of relationships. Episode 9, in its uncensored form, serves as a pivotal chapter that transitions the protagonist, Michio Kaga, from a state of precarious survival to one of relative stability and deliberate social engineering. This paper argues that Episode 9 is less about erotic spectacle and more about the cold, systematic application of isekai “rules” to human emotions and labor, using the uncensored visuals to emphasize the contractual and physical reality of Michio’s harem.
